У меня есть PHP, который, вероятно, займет 10 или (даже много) больше секунд. Я хотел бы показать прогресс для него для пользователя. В исполняемом классе у меня есть свойство $progress которое обновляется с прогрессом (в 1-100), и метод get_progress() (цель которого должна быть очевидной). Вопрос в том, как обновить элемент <progress> в передней части для […]
У меня есть базовая страница с навигационной панелью сверху и тело обертки. Всякий раз, когда пользователь нажимает на ссылку навигации, он использует .load для загрузки содержимого страницы в обертку div. $(this).ajaxStart(function(){$('.progressbar .bar').css('width','5%');$('.progressbar').fadeIn();}); $(this).ajaxEnd(function(){$('progressbar').hide();}); $('.ajaxspl').on('click',function(e){ e.preventDefault(); var url=$(this).data('url'), wrap=$('body #wrap'); //clean the wrapper wrap.slideUp().html(''); //load page into wrapper wrap.load(url,function(){wrap.slideDown();}); }); Пример возвращаемого значения из .load : […]
<form enctype="multipart/form-data" action="upload.php" method="POST"> <input name="uploaded" type="file" /> <input type="submit" value="Upload" /> </form> <?php if(isset($_REQUEST['submit'])){ $target = "data/".basename( $_FILES['uploaded']['name']) ; move_uploaded_file($_FILES['uploaded']['tmp_name'], $target); } ?> Я знаю Javascript, AJAX и JQuery и т. Д., И я считаю, что индикатор выполнения загрузки может быть создан с использованием PHP, AJAX и Javascript и т. Д. Я удивлен, как […]
У меня есть страница, которая использует функции jjery ajax для отправки некоторых сообщений. Для отправки может быть отправлено более 50 тыс. Сообщений. Это может занять некоторое время. То, что я хочу сделать, это показать индикатор выполнения с отправляемыми сообщениями. Бэкэнд – это PHP. Как я могу это сделать? Мое решение: отправьте уникальный идентификатор в исходный […]
Кто-нибудь знает о каких-либо методах создания бара выполнения загрузки файлов в PHP? Я часто слышал, что это невозможно. У меня есть одна идея, но не уверен, что это сработает: иметь обычную загрузку файла, а вместо этого отправлять в iframe. Когда это отправлено, храните информацию о файле (размер и временное местоположение) в сеансе. В то же […]
Я пытаюсь найти простой учебник, в котором рассказывается о том, как добавить процент прогресса к загрузке файла, я уже создал часть загрузки файла, поэтому мне не нужен плагин, который поставляется с обоими, я хочу быть способный самостоятельно кодировать индикатор выполнения, но мне нужна помощь в том, как это сделать. Я хочу узнать, как это работает, […]
Я знаю, что здесь есть несколько тем, но ни один из них не предложил определенного решения для сценария загрузчика файлов, который: Работает на IE7 + Имеет индикатор выполнения (в каждом браузере) Нет Flash (или резервный) Любые решения?
У меня есть этот цикл while, который в основном проходит через множество записей в базе данных и вставляет данные в другой: $q = $con1->query($users1) or die(print_r($con2->errorInfo(),1)); while($row = $q->fetch(PDO::FETCH_ASSOC)){ $q = $con2->prepare($users2); $q->execute(array($row['id'], $row['username'])) or die(print_r($con2-errorInfo(),1)); } (Сценарий был сокращен для удобства чтения – правильный имеет гораздо более длинный массив) Я хотел бы сделать это […]